The Testing Board of Review (TBR) and the commissioner of education work together to ensure the integrity of all state-required assessments is maintained. The Testing Board of Review is charged by 703 KAR 5:080 with providing a recommendation to the commissioner of education regarding testing allegations reported to the Kentucky Department of Education (KDE).
The commissioner appoints board members to represent various divisions within KDE. To maintain the independence of the board, members do not include persons whose job duties consist of either investigating testing allegations or those who work in the assessment and accountability area of KDE. Each board member receives Administration Code Training.
